Transaction 28d754a990c7444fddc7e9cae611945703fd3edbce4bd657b082350268521f33

1 Input
2 Outputs
  • 28d754a990c7444fddc7e9cae611945703fd3edbce4bd657b082350268521f33:0
  • value  75849678
    address  37MU49aYw2SmutyxxHFWBkyuXMCvoz52Ms
  • 28d754a990c7444fddc7e9cae611945703fd3edbce4bd657b082350268521f33:1
  • value  2780000
    address  1Hmu8ENC3QewoHBKGbTFtNGQoUkSDND1rT